如何在 Ubuntu 上安装 NVM for Node.js
Node Version Manager (NVM) 是一个流行的工具,用于在单台机器上管理多个版本的 Node.js。它简化了安装、更新以及在不同 Node.js 版本之间切换的过程,使其成为 Node.js 开发者的必备工具。如果你正在使用 Ubuntu,NVM 的安装快速且简单。本指南将引导你完成在你的 Ubuntu system 上安装 NVM 的步骤。
前提条件:
一个全新的 Ubuntu system(Ubuntu 20.04/22.04 或更新版本)。
可使用具有用户权限的终端(root 或具有 sudo 访问权限的用户)。
步骤 1:更新你的系统
首先,通过运行以下命令确保你的系统已更新到最新状态:
sudo apt update && sudo apt upgrade -y步骤 2:安装依赖项
在安装 NVM 之前,请确保你的系统已安装
curl,因为它是获取安装脚本所必需的。
sudo apt install curl -y步骤 3:使用 cURL 安装 NVM
现在,你可以通过运行安装脚本来安装 NVM。执行以下命令,从其官方仓库下载并安装 NVM:
cur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.39.3/install.sh | bash此命令会下载安装脚本并将其通过管道传递给
bash,后者会在你的系统上安装 NVM。该脚本将自动:
将必要的环境变量添加到你的
~/.bashrc、
~/.bash_profile或
~/.zshrc文件中,具体取决于你的 shell。
安装最新稳定版本的 NVM。
步骤 4:重新加载 Shell
安装完成后,你需要重新加载你的 shell 配置,使更改生效。运行以下命令:
source ~/.bashrc如果你使用的是不同的 shell(例如 Zsh),可以运行:
source ~/.zshrc或者,你也可以关闭并重新打开终端。
步骤 5:验证 NVM 安装
要确认 NVM 已成功安装,请运行:
nvm --version这应该会显示已安装的 NVM 版本,表明该工具现在可供使用。
步骤 6:使用 NVM 安装 Node.js
现在 NVM 已安装,你可以轻松安装任何版本的 Node.js。例如,要安装最新稳定版本的 Node.js,请使用:
nvm install node此命令会安装最新稳定版的 Node.js。要安装特定版本,请将
node替换为所需的版本号:
nvm install 14.17.0步骤 7:在不同 Node.js 版本之间切换
NVM 允许你轻松在不同版本的 Node.js 之间切换。要查看系统上已安装了哪些版本,请运行:
nvm ls要切换到特定版本,请使用:
nvm use 14.17.0如果你想为系统设置一个默认的 Node.js 版本,请使用:
nvm alias default 14.17.0步骤 8:卸载 Node.js 版本
如果你需要卸载某个 Node.js 版本,可以使用:
nvm uninstall 14.17.0结论
在 Ubuntu 上安装 NVM 可以让你轻松管理多个 Node.js 版本,这在开发环境中特别有用,因为不同项目可能需要不同的版本。这个过程很简单,而且借助 NVM,你可以根据需要快速安装、切换和移除 Node.js 版本。
如果你遇到任何问题或需要进一步帮助,请告诉我!


